The size of The Rock is approximately 286.5 square kilometres. There are 2 parks, covering nearly 1.3% of the total area. The population of The Rock in 2016 was 1236 people. By 2021 the population was 1347 showing a population growth of 9.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in The Rock is 0-9 years. Households in The Rock are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in The Rock work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 80.70% of the homes in The Rock were owner-occupied compared with 82.10% in 2016.
